Now living in Bangor and studying Music and Creative Writing at the uni, Aditi Saigal or Dot. is an Indian indie musician with a loyal YouTube following. See this video of her debut tour in India with the audience singing along… we’re really excited for the concert in Neuadd Ogwen Bethesda on 16 June!

Abou Baga began his musical journey on the Comoro Islands off the coast of East Africa, where he sang and played traditional Swahili music. Since 2005 he has been living in Paris where he is a favourite on the African music scene, which is the best outside Africa, bringing together people from all over that continent. Continue reading
